1st cruise

This was our first cruise so we don't have anything to compare it to but we had a great time.  We weren't disappointed by anything. We were really glad that we spent the extra money for the balcony.  Without the balcony it would have been an entirely different experience.  The food was actually pretty good.  The service was excellent!

We enjoyed Puerta Vallarta and would highly recommend the Tequila Factory tour. Loved the tour guide (Pepe). Just wished we would have had more time on the second day because we saw some things that we would have liked to visit on our own, but we didn't have enough time.

The time in Cabo was very limited so we took a tour (Land's End, Beach & Shopping).  The tour was okay but nothing to rave about.  It served the purpose of insuring we could see a few things and still get back to the ship on time. The tour guide (Oscar) was extremely hard to understand.  His English was okay but he talked so fast you couldn't really understand him. 

The entertainment on the ship was pretty marginal. Their evening shows weren't very good.  Considering how many highly talented people they are it seemed funny that they couldn't hire people that could actually sing. The comedians at the Comedy club were really good so we enjoyed those performances.

We enjoyed the sea days but it would have been better if we could have had some sort of entertainment available.  This is a pretty small ship so I guess they consider trivia and bingo entertainment.

Overall it was a great experience and we will do another cruise next year.  We did this one to as a trial to see if we would enjoy cruising.  We did so our next cruise will be in Europe.

Cabo San Lucas, Mexico

Time was very limited here. Lots of time is used up getting on and off of the ship since you have to tender. There is no dock.
